Hope for Evangelicals Yet

As someone who attends an evangelical church but finds myself with traditionally un-evangelical political views, this article is a breath of fresh air:

Before the last presidential election, [Rev. Gregory Boyd of Woodland Hills Church in St. Paul, MN] preached six sermons called “The Cross and the Sword” in which he said the church should steer clear of politics, give up moralizing on sexual issues, stop claiming the United States as a “Christian nation” and stop glorifying American military campaigns.

“When the church wins the culture wars, it inevitably loses,” Mr. Boyd preached. “When it conquers the world, it becomes the world. When you put your trust in the sword, you lose the cross.”
